COMPANY BACKGROUND

Epiq Solutions develops cutting-edge software-defined radio (SDR) products and processing solutions to enable spectrum dominance for maritime, land, air, and space domains. With 15 years serving government and commercial enterprise customers and 25K+ devices fielded to date, Epiq Solutions is a trusted partner with a proven heritage of delivering open architecture products in radically small form factors where time-to-market, cost, and performance are critical for mission success.

JOB R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Design and implement complex FPGA designs including requirements analysis, specification, RTL coding, simulation, and verification.
  • Optimize FPGA designs for performance, resource utilization, power, and cost.
  • Collaborate with hardware engineers to define board-level interfaces and ensure the successful integration of FPGA designs.
  • Develop and maintain FPGA design documentation, including design specifications, test plans, and user guides.
  • Participate in code reviews and promote best practices in RTL coding and design.
  • Develop FPGA verification environments using self-checking testbenches and advanced verification methodologies.
  • Debug and troubleshoot FPGA designs at both the hardware and system level.
  • Participate in architectural discussions and contribute to the development of system-level solutions.
  • Maintain knowledge of the latest FPGA technologies and best practices to ensure designs are up-to-date and efficient.
  • Support the creation of project timelines and milestones, ensuring FPGA design tasks meet project deadlines.
  • Interface with customers and stakeholders to gather requirements and provide technical support as needed.
  • Continuously improve the FPGA development process, proposing and implementing design and verification flow enhancements.
  • Mentor and coach junior staff on FPGA design techniques and industry standards.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ams including software, mechanical, and systems engineering to deliver high-quality products.
JOB REQUIREMENTS
  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, Computer Science, or a related field
  • Minimum of 7 years of experience in FPGA design and development
  • Ability to work with cross-functional teams (software, hardware, and mechanical engineers) to integrate and debug systems
  • Excellent problem-solving and analytical skills
  • Proficiency in hardware description languages (HDLs), such as VHDL or Verilog
  • Deep understanding of the FPGA implementation process including synthesis, place and route, and timing closure
  • Knowledge and understanding of RF digital signal processing (DSP) techniques and implementation on FPGAs
  • Experience with AMD FPGAs and SoC’s (Artix, Kintex, Zynq MPSoC, Versal) and AMD adaptive computing design implementation and verification tools (Vivado, Vitis)
  • Understanding of high-speed communication protocols and interfaces such as PCIe, Gigabit Ethernet, JESD204B/C, DDR, etc.
  • Strong background in electronics and circuit design, including schematic entry and PCB layout, and power considerations for FPGAs
  • Experience with version control systems, like Git or SVN
  • Eligibility to work on Federal contracts which require US Citizenship
